Transaction edd36d15a329ba832c2c8a66567b686f22500754d00a0b9e713dccc71fa4b0ba
1 Input
1 Output
-
edd36d15a329ba832c2c8a66567b686f22500754d00a0b9e713dccc71fa4b0ba:0
- value
- 139037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 204c9192704ccfbb504c374f5ecfe362bbf2c41b OP_EQUAL
- address
- 34doGmJszq8YV6ppju1EhDmWYowgikcxe5